The MagDrone R3 is an ultra portable magnetometer to be attached to any UAV with a minimum payload of 1kg.

Recommended applications:

  • Searching for UXO (UneXploded Ordnance)
  • Locating buried infrastructure (metal pipes and shielded cables) and power cables under the load
  • Archaeology
  • Surveying for any metal objects weighing a few hundred grams or heavier lying underground

MagDrone R3 (starting from SN SN000200) has a built-in GPS AND the possibility to connect an external one. Second configuration is recommended to achieve better geotagging of the data, especially when R3 is used with SkyHub onboard computer and RTK-equipped drone.

Note, that general rule with magnetometer when it is necessary to detect artificial objects or artefacts - fly as low as possible. Recommended altitude for the tasks like UXO search - 1m above surface or even lower. That means that drone should be equipped with terrain following system (included in recommended magnetometer bundle).

Recommended drones to carry MagDrone R3: DJI M350 RTK, DJI M300 RTK, DJI M210, DJI M600 Pro.

UXO/landmines detection note

The system is capable to detect a range of items starting from hand grenades (the estimated sensor-target distance for detecting an object such as the F1 hand grenade is 0.5 m) till big UXO like aerial bombs at the distance of few meters.

While magnetometers can detect some types of landmines (for example M15, M6, TM-62M anti-tank mines; M16, PROM-1, OZM-3, OZM-4, OZM-72 anti-personnel mines and similar types with considerable amounts of ferrous metal), landmines search is not a direct application of magnetometers as they can’t detect most types of modern landmines. That means that the system never should be used to confirm absence of landmines (and small ordnance) in certain area but it can be valuable asset during Non-Technical Survey (NTS) or Technical Survey (TS) to confirm presence of UXO/landmines with considerable amount of ferrous metals.
